Ken Irving wrote:
I traced the problem to code in leafnode's nntpd.c source, in function donewgroups(), then found that the problem had been fixed (and identified as a Y2K fix) in leafnode 1.9.5. A patch for this can be found on the leafnode mailing list, http://www.fredi.de/maillist/msg00771.html.
I think 1.9.7 is current now. I don't think any show stoppers exist between 1.9.5 and 1.9.7 but if you are going to upgrade you might as well go all the way.
